Road Safety, Family Stops, and Fatigue Management

Infrastructure Safety & Road Quality

Illinois and Wisconsin highways are generally well-lit and have good signage. The UP's US-2 is a two-lane road with occasional passing zones; watch for deer, especially at dawn and dusk. Cell service is spotty in northern Wisconsin and the UP—download offline maps. Emergency services: dial 911; roadside assistance via AAA or similar.

Pet-Friendly Framework

Many attractions allow pets on leashes. State and national parks (Pictured Rocks) permit dogs on most trails but not on boat tours. Hotels like La Quinta and Motel 6 are pet-friendly. Restaurants with outdoor seating often welcome dogs. Carry a travel water bowl and waste bags.

Natural Landscapes and Local Commerce

Natural Landscapes & Attractions

The route passes through three distinct eco-regions: the Mississippi River bluffs, the Wisconsin Northwoods, and Michigan's Upper Peninsula. The most dramatic natural attraction awaits at the end: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ore, with its multicolored sandstone cliffs, sea caves, and waterfalls like Munising Falls and Miners Falls.

Along the way, stop at Starved Rock State Park in Illinois (1 hour detour), with its canyons and waterfalls. In Wisconsin, the Wisconsin Dells area offers gorges and the Wisconsin River. In the UP, Kitch-iti-kipi (the Big Spring) is a must-see natural pool at Palms Book State Park.

Climatic Conditions & Route Aesthetics

Summer (June–August) brings warm temperatures (70–80°F) and lush greenery. Autumn (September–October) offers spectacular fall colors, especially in the UP. Spring can be rainy; winter sees heavy snow and shorter daylight hours. For the best aesthetic experience, aim for late September, when the aspens and maples are at peak color.
